#pygwidgets (pronounced as: "pig wijits")

An open collection of user interface widgets for use with pygame development.

7/23 Version 1.1

SpriteSheetAnimationCollection class added

AnimationCollection class added

TextRadioButton: Added optional color for text and circle (radio button)

Added ability to work with PyInstaller to create executable application

(builds proper paths on-the-fly)

SoundEffect class added

BackgroundSound class added

Button classes: added activationKeysList to press a button based on any list of keys

(enterToActivate still works and builds the list of activation keys for you)

CheckBox classes: Added toggleValue() method

3/23 Version 1.0.4

Image - fixed two scale and rotate bugs (thanks to Lando Chan)

TextInput - add setLoc to work correctly when moving an input field (thanks to Renato Monteiro)

SpriteSheetAnimation - fixed bug in splitting images (thanks to Alex Stamps)

Button classes: 'soundOnClick' didn't do anything ... now plays the sound on click

To install, open the command line and enter the following:

python3 -m pip install -U pip --user

python3 -m pip install -U pygwidgets --user

The first command ensures that you have the latest version of pip (the installer).

The second line installs the latest version of pygwidgets from PyPI into the site-packages folder on your computer, so that this package is available to all of your Python programs.
